Législatives partielles à Toumodi : Hervé Alliali (PDCI-RDA) réélu avec 56,11 %
In the Toumodi electoral district, located in the Bélier region, Hervé Alliali , candidate of the Democratic Party of Côte d'Ivoire – African Democratic Rally (PDCI-RDA) , was re-elected deputy following the partial legislative elections of February 21, 2026. He obtained approximately 56.11% of the votes cast , according to the available results.
This by-election followed the annulment of the initial election of December 27, 2025, by the Constitutional Council, which had noted irregularities in the constituency. The rerun of the vote took place in a generally calm and secure atmosphere, marked by calls for peace and mobilization from the two main candidates and local political leaders.
The election pitted Hervé Alliali of the PDCI-RDA against Raymonde Goudou Coffie , candidate of the Rally of Houphouëtists for Democracy and Peace (RHDP) . Throughout election day, both candidates called for unity and calm, emphasizing the importance of a peaceful vote in the interest of the people of Toumodi.
Hervé Alliali's victory consolidates the PDCI-RDA's representation in this constituency and reflects significant voter mobilization in favor of its candidate. This electoral rerun is also seen as an important test for local democracy , in a context where social stability and public order remain central issues.
The re-elected MP will officially take office in the coming weeks, once the results have been definitively validated by the competent authorities.
